Zavvi.com

Have had problems with this company stating items are IN STOCK then failing to deliver or even reply to queries.

Eventually someone replied [after referring them to Trading Standards] and made apologies and promises to not put me through it again if I just try them once more.

They issued credit which I eventually got around to using. Site showed the reduction being made to published price but days later I find that the full amount has been taken from my credit card [and the credit on my Zavvi a/c now down to zero...so the 'gift' has vanished; unused.]

Now am in the same position, they ignore the online a/c enquiries despite stating they will reply in one working day [been over a week now].

See they are owned by HUT.COM so used their site to complain but so far nothing from them neither.

SO..........just to share a bad experience.
